Despite the fact that we regularly have a small number of wintering Red-necked Grebes every year in the SF Bay Area, I'd never photographed one of the species until my first visit to Alaska in spring of 2011. They were present in profusion, courting and nesting, and displaying their bright breeding plumage, on the lakes in the Anchorage area, especially Westchester Lagoon, and Lake Lucille in Wasilla, where Doug Lloyd introduced us to the beauties of his hometown.
